why the series resistor of the voltmeter is high

The series resistor of voltmeter is high because it is connected parallel in circuit and used to measure the voltage between two points, So we need the current flow in the element whose voltage you are trying to measure and does not branch to voltmeter so, the resistance of voltmeter must be high.
